Hi guys,

I've been out of car audio for awhile. I have a 2002 Dodge neon and I'm going to put high end, new (old school) PPI DCX 525S comps in the doors, subs in the trunk, and I have a Sony DVD player with Dolby surround. I'll add surround sound rear deck speakers at a later date.

I want to buy an amp.... This is a Dodge neon so it's a little compact car.... the battery is really small, it looks like the battery wires are only 8 gauge, lol

I just want a sound quality system, not interested in turning heads outside the car.... I'm thinking a 5-channel full class D amp for efficiency, around 700 to 900 watts total rated RMS.... Is this car/battery going to be enough for one moderate/small amp like that? I have 4-guage wire I can run to the battery.

I'm thinking full class D?

I myself was thinking about trying one of these out,. But I ended up getting my PPI Phantom 5 ch. out of the box. Specs look good, and look like plenty of setting adjustments for tuning, and a space saver also. it prob wouldnt hurt to try and get the Big 3 done and look at a pretty decent AGM under the hood for future power needs. I had a Honda CRV with a 90 amp alt. and ended up running 2 Good sized AGM batts( 1 under the hood and one in the rear) and did the Big 3 and seemed to have had plenty of supply for the demand.
